During a White House press briefing on Thursday, President Donald Trump's remarks on environmental policy and funding demands were largely overshadowed by an unexpected internet sensation: a man with a remarkably prominent belly button. The unidentified individual, standing behind the President during an Oval Office session, became the subject of widespread social media attention, with screenshots and commentary quickly circulating online.
The press conference itself focused on the Trump administration's intention to ease regulations on greenhouse gas emissions from cooling equipment, a move that signaled a rollback of a Biden-era rule. President Trump also addressed the Republican Senate majority's stance on a $1 billion funding request for parts of a controversial White House ballroom project. However, these significant policy discussions quickly took a backseat to the visual anomaly captured in the background.

Presidential Remarks on Funding and Policy
Amidst the social media buzz, President Trump did address other matters during the briefing. He commented on the Republican Senate majority's potential support for a border security funding bill, which notably excluded the $1 billion he had requested for the White House ballroom. Trump vehemently denied claims that he was seeking taxpayer funds for the project, characterizing such reports as "the biggest misreporting that I’ve ever seen." He asserted that the project was proceeding on schedule and within budget, with ample funding secured through conjunctions with the military and the Secret Service.
The President emphasized his confidence in the project's progress, stating, "It’s going beautifully. Have all the money I need."
